Read MoreFlat pancakes = baaaaaad. Fluffy pancakes = goooooood. The key here is to not over mix your batter! Also, make sure your skillet is pre-heated for these bad boys. Final tip: use under-ripe bananas so that your bananas foster don't turn to mush.

Read MoreKrembos are an Israeli treat that consists of a cookie base and marshmallow centre, coated in chocolate. These remind me of Viva Puffs but are way more delicious and without the jam in the centre. These freeze well too!
